  • Rachel Leviss sues Tom Sandoval and Ariana Madix for revenge porn – National | Globalnews.ca

    Rachel Leviss sues Tom Sandoval and Ariana Madix for revenge porn – National | Globalnews.ca

    [ad_1]

    Last year, Scandoval was tried in the court of public opinion.

    Now, Vanderpump Rules star Rachel (formerly Raquel) Leviss is taking the cheating scandal to a court of law.

    In a new lawsuit filed Thursday in Los Angeles Superior Court, Leviss, 29, accused co-stars Tom Sandoval, 40, and Ariana Madix, 38, of revenge porn, eavesdropping, invasion of privacy and intentional infliction of emotional distress.

    According to entertainment publication US Weekly, which obtained and viewed the legal filing, Leviss alleges that Sandoval recorded a sex tape of her without her consent.

    Leviss and Sandoval infamously had a bombshell affair that came to light during Season 10 of Vanderpump Rules, when Sandoval was in a nearly decade-long relationship with Madix. The affair — which would go on to be known as “Scandoval” among the show’s fans — grabbed international headlines in March 2023 and brought record-breaking viewership to the show. Much of the scandal revolved around the alleged existence of a sexual FaceTime call between Leviss and Sandoval, which Leviss said Sandoval recorded without her permission.

    Story continues below advertisement

    Leviss is seeking unspecified damages and destruction of the sex tape. She has requested a jury trial.

    Sandoval and Madix have yet to comment publicly on the lawsuit or the accusations.


    The email you need for the day’s
    top news stories from Canada and around the world.

    In the lawsuit, Leviss says the massive public attention surrounding the cheating scandal saw her “humiliated and villainized for public consumption.” She argues she “remains a shell of her former self, with her career prospects stunted and her reputation in tatters.”

    Scandoval, according to the legal filing, made Leviss “without exaggeration, one of the most hated women in America.”

    Leviss told the court she checked herself into a “mental health facility” for three months as public interest in Scandoval exploded.

    While noting that she has apologized to Madix “repeatedly” for her “morally objectionable” actions, Leviss, through her lawyers, claimed there is more to the story than the public is aware of.

    “Lost in the mix was that Leviss was a victim of the predatory and dishonest behavior of an older man, who recorded sexually explicit videos of her without her knowledge or consent, which were then distributed, disseminated, and discussed publicly by a scorned woman seeking vengeance, catalyzing the scandal,” the filing read.

    Leviss said she was “misled” by reps at Bravo, the network that airs Vanderpump Rules, into believing she could not publicly comment about the situation.

    Story continues below advertisement

    “It is clear that Bravo deliberately sacrificed Leviss for the sake of its commercial interests from its refusal to allow her the opportunity to tell her side of the story and defend herself, which she repeatedly begged for permission to do,” the lawsuit reads.

    Earlier in 2023, Leviss also hit several of her Vanderpump Rules co-stars with cease-and-desist letters insisting they stop speaking about the intimate video, as it constituted a violation of California’s “nonconsensual pornography” laws.

    (One Vanderpump Rules cast member, Lala Kent, would go on to apparently earn enough money to pay the downpayment on her house after calling out Leviss for the cease-and-desist online. Kent told Leviss to send the legal notice to her lawyer, Darrell, then capitalized off the sale of merchandise reading, “Send it to Darrell!”)

    Bravo, NBCUniversal and the Vanderpump Rules producers, including Andy Cohen, are not named as defendants in the lawsuit. As of this writing, there has been no public comment from any of these parties, either.

    Leviss has so far not appeared in Season 11 of Vanderpump Rules, which is currently airing.

  • REPORT: Vanderpump Rules Banned From Filming at Schwartz & Sandy’s After Sandoval’s Affair, Plus Schwartz Discusses Scheana Kiss and ‘Scandoval’ Regrets

    REPORT: Vanderpump Rules Banned From Filming at Schwartz & Sandy’s After Sandoval’s Affair, Plus Schwartz Discusses Scheana Kiss and ‘Scandoval’ Regrets

    [ad_1]

    Vanderpump Rules cameras were reportedly banned from filming scenes for season 11 at Schwartz & Sandy’s following the backlash the restaurant and bar received in the wake of co-owner Tom Sandoval‘s affair with Rachel “Raquel” Leviss.

    According to a new report, one of the venue’s other co-owners, Greg Morris, kept Bravo and its production company away from Schwartz & Sandy’s, which opened in November 2022, because he felt that exposing the venue to more fandom would “ruin the business more than it had already been ruined.”

    “Production was banned from filming at Schwartz & Sandy’s for season 11 because there was so much toxicity that was aimed at the restaurant,” a source told The U.S. Sun on January 31. “The abundant amount of toxicity aimed at the restaurant led to many issues with staff, whether it was working there for the wrong reasons, like, trying to get camera attention or added pressure they received while trying to serve the guests.”

    Schwartz & Sandy’s “went through a very tough time” after Sandoval’s affair with Raquel, 29, was uncovered in March 2023, and exposing more of that drama on Pump Rules was not something Greg wanted to do.

    “Greg took control and did not allow cameras to film at Schwartz & Sandy’s because he felt like the restaurant and everyone who worked there was unfairly targeted,” the insider explained. “S&S took a big hit and Greg thought filming there would ruin the business more than it had already been ruined post-Scandoval.”

    As Pump Rules fans have likely noticed, Sandoval and Schwartz didn’t film the series’ opening credits at Schwartz & Sandy’s, as expected. Rather, they were seen at the bar of their other restaurant, TomTom.

    “As for the opening credits, there was never a discussion about them not filming at Schwartz & Sandy’s for the opening credits. It was just assumed that they could not film the opening credits there since it wasn’t part of the season,” the source noted. “It can also be assumed that since [Lisa Vanderpump] is the executive producer on VPR, she would rather promote the bar she has invested in rather than theirs.”

    After Sandoval’s betrayal of Ariana Madix, 38, was made public, he was reportedly “pushed out” of Schwartz & Sandy’s by staff who “couldn’t stand him” and was “rarely” seen at the restaurant.

    “Schwartz has been picking up the pieces and has been very hands-on because he did not want to see all their hard work suffer and did not want to let Greg down,” the source said. “Schwartz and Greg became very close and even Greg was putting in a lot of legwork and made sure everything didn’t implode.”

    Nearly one year later, and as Sandoval begins to frequent the venue more, the insider said there’s still hope that the restaurant will be seen on Pump Rules‘ potential 12th season.

    “Greg and the Tom Toms have had recent discussions where they sat down and tried to make a game plan of how they can refocus on S&S and just put the past behind them,” the source stated. “Greg is hoping that people’s minds will change about S&S and it can have a successful comeback. Both guys have other commitments taking up their time, but they’re doing their best to refocus on S&S. Who knows, maybe for season 12 – if there is one – Schwartz & Sandy’s can be featured on the show again.”

  • Vanderpump Rules' Ariana Madix Sues Ex Tom Sandoval Over Sale of $2 Million Home as Lawsuit Details Are Revealed, Plus What She Wants Judge to Do

    Vanderpump Rules' Ariana Madix Sues Ex Tom Sandoval Over Sale of $2 Million Home as Lawsuit Details Are Revealed, Plus What She Wants Judge to Do

    [ad_1]

    Ariana Madix has filed a lawsuit against ex-boyfriend, Tom Sandoval, amid her efforts to unload the $2 million home they’ve shared for the past several years, including the months that followed the reveal of his affair with Rachel “Raquel” Leviss.

    As the former Vanderpump Rules couple continues to co-own the home, Ariana, 38, is taking legal measures that she hopes will force Sandoval, 41, into selling the home, which they purchased in 2019, so that they can both move on with their lives.

    According to court documents obtained by TMZ on January 5 and filed in a Los Angeles Superior Court, Ariana wants a “partition by sale,” in which a judge would order her and Sandoval to sell their home and split the profits, rather than a “division in kind,” which would allow them to maintain ownership interest in the property and — and potentially let one of them sell the property to a third party.

    Ariana’s filing comes just weeks after a sneak peek at the upcoming 11th season of Pump Rules featured her complaining to Katie Maloney, 36, about Sandoval’s hesitancy to sell.

    “Three months ago, when Tom blew up our lives, I was not, like, prepared to be kicked out of my house and start a whole new freaking life. So even though we still live under the same roof, I’ve been able to maintain a no-contact policy. We communicate via his assistant Anne, which is great for me because I don’t have to look at his stupid face, but bad for Anne because that’s literally her job,” Ariana revealed.

    Ariana then said that because she and Sandoval weren’t in agreement about the fate of their home, they had continued to live there together.

    “I feel like the house is the last thing that’s tying things. But what I think is psychotic is that he wants to buy me out and stay here,” Ariana shared. “You don’t have to move and I do? What, are you gonna bring your little pen pal back over here? I don’t f*cking think so.”

    Around the same time, Ariana appeared on an episode of Watch What Happens Live, where she spoke of how she’s been handling the co-owning of her home with Sandoval.

    “During the time that I’ve been on Dancing With the Stars and preparing for it, I, for the most part, have been in an Airbnb with my dog and my cat and some of my things, but I regularly go back and forth, and I’m working on the situation with the ownership of the house. I would love for that to be resolved quickly,” Ariana explained.

    “Whatever happens with it has to be agreed upon between both owners, hence the issue. I wanna sell it. He does not,” she added.
